/*!
* Specification for which direction(s) to grow the gridmap in.
*/
enum Direction
{
CENTERED, // Grow the gridmap in all directions evenly from the center.
NE, // Grow in the +X and +Y (Quadrant 1).
NW, // Grow in the -X and +Y (Quadrant 2).
SW, // Grow in the -X and -Y (Quadrant 3).
SE // Grow in the +X and -Y (Quadrant 4).
};

/*!
* Increase the size of the grid map while retaining old data.
* @param length the new side lengths in x, and y-direction of the grid map [m].
* @param direction the direction to grow in (default = SE).
* @param value the value new elements should be initialized with.
*/
void grow(const Length& length, const Direction direction=SE, float value=0.0);

void GridMap::grow(const Length& length, const Direction direction, float value)
{
if (length(0) < length_(0) || length(1) < length_(1))
{
return;
}

Length delta(length(0) - length_(0), length(1) - length_(1));

Size size;
size(0) = static_cast<int>(round(length(0) / resolution_));
size(1) = static_cast<int>(round(length(1) / resolution_));
conservativeResize(size, direction, value);
length_ = length;

// Update position
switch (direction)
{
case CENTERED:
break;

case NE:
position_(0) += delta(0)/2;
position_(1) -= delta(1)/2;
break;

case NW:
position_(0) += delta(0)/2;
position_(1) += delta(1)/2;
break;

case SW:
position_(0) -= delta(0)/2;
position_(1) += delta(1)/2;
break;

default:
position_(0) -= delta(0)/2;
position_(1) -= delta(1)/2;
break;
}
}

void GridMap::conservativeResize(const Index& size, const Direction direction, float value)
{
int row_delta = size(0) - size_(0);
int col_delta = size(1) - size_(1);

Eigen::MatrixXf like = Eigen::MatrixXf::Constant(size(0), size(1), value);
for (auto& data : data_)
{
data.second.conservativeResizeLike(like);

// Swap rows and columns as needed
switch (direction)
{
case CENTERED:
for (int i = size_(0)-1; i >= 0; i--)
{
data.second.row(i).swap(data.second.row(i+row_delta/2));
}
for (int i = size_(1)-1; i >= 0; i--)
{
data.second.col(i).swap(data.second.col(i+col_delta/2));
}
break;

case NE:
for (int i = size_(0)-1; i >= 0; i--)
{
data.second.row(i).swap(data.second.row(i+row_delta));
}
break;

case NW:
for (int i = size_(0)-1; i >= 0; i--)
{
data.second.row(i).swap(data.second.row(i+row_delta));
}
for (int i = size_(1)-1; i >= 0; i--)
{
data.second.col(i).swap(data.second.col(i+col_delta));
}
break;

case SW:
for (int i = size_(1)-1; i >= 0; i--)
{
data.second.col(i).swap(data.second.col(i+col_delta));
}
break;

default:
break;
}
}

size_ = size;
}
